What You’ll Do

Explore comforting seasonal dishes in a relaxed, hands-on format.

Celebrate seasonal flavors in this hands-on cooking class in The Woodlands. Learn how to prepare seared pork tenderloin stuffed with Tuscan kale and pancetta, a crisp apple and fennel salad and a rich butternut squash gratin with ricotta and hazelnuts. Finish with warm apple bread pudding drizzled with salted caramel sauce. Chef Boris or a resident chef will guide you step by step through every dish. This cooking class in The Woodlands is perfect for anyone who enjoys hearty, seasonal recipes and practical kitchen skills.

Tea, coffee and water will be provided. Guests are welcome to bring non-alcoholic beverages.

This class is suitable for ages 14+ with an adult present. Children under 17 must be accompanied by a paying adult. Class price is per person.
